There are big benefits to having power generation grid connected.

It is more reliable (due to many possible generation sources). It is more eco-friendly (solar in daytime, wind when the wind blows). It is more cost efficient (no need to overbuild for peak usage, generators don't sit idle when computers are off for maintenance).

Yet our electricity grid has such a mass of regulations attached that people are choosing to lose these benefits - and with it we lose the benefit of them connecting to our grid.
